Hicks selected as Mendenhall River Community School principal

Posted: Friday, July 23, 2010

The Juneau School District chose James Hicks of Sublimity, Ore. as the new principal for Mendenhall River Community School on Wednesday. Hicks replaces Patty Newman who left the position to become director of curriculum and instruction with the JSD.

"I am very happy and excited about his selection," Juneau Superintendent Glenn Gelbrich said. "The selection committee saw in Jim someone who could help build on the success they have been achieving. They also saw someone who is a really good listener and that was what we heard from the people we talked to at his previous posts. He is not afraid to make a decision."

Hicks' last job in Juneau was a little different than what he will be doing for the local community but his love for Alaska is still the same.

"I have great memories of Juneau," Hicks said. "I was a busboy for the Hilton Hotel while visiting one summer when I was 18. I remember seeing all the green trees and the setting and there is really nothing like the people in Alaska. I am very excited to be coming back to Alaska."

A panel of school district staff, teachers and parents recommended Hicks after a national search and public interview process in early July. District administrators visited his home school district to meet with his peers last week.

"I get the opportunity to come in Monday and meet with staff at an open house and see where they feel we are at as a school, what their priorities are, what they value, and what they think are our strengths and weaknesses," Hicks said. "I am there to support them. I am there to figure out what is working well and just try to continue to make it a stronger program."

Hicks previously spent 23 years in Kodiak. He began his education at the University of Alaska's Kodiak College, graduating with a bachelor's degree in elementary education. He later earned a master's degree in education with a bilingual emphasis from Western Oregon University. His completed his administrator and leadership training at Portland State University.
